I've got a "Good News / Bad News" situation here. Since we're all gamers, I thought I'd give everyone a dialogue option, so you can decide which order you read the news in.

Hover the spoiler tags in the order you'd like.

GOOD NEWS

New content is coming to the demo on June 1st! For the first time ever, a piece of Chapter 2 will be available to play. Plus, you'll be able to experience The Arcade, so you can battle all the enemies again without needing to hunt them down in the world.

And due to popular demand, I'm also adding the entirety of Chapter 1 back into the demo, so there'll be a good 2 hours of content here, with all the replayability of The Arcade. An important warning though: save files will not transfer over to the full game.

And if you decided to read the Good News first, it's time to hold your breath for the Bad News...

BAD NEWS Nocturne's release date has been moved to September 24th. The reality is, after 10 years of development, it just needs a bit more time in the oven. If I attempted to launch on the original date, you would definitely notice the quality of the game takes a dip in later chapters. These parts of the game need the extra polish and bug fixes the earlier chapters have got, and I know it'll be worth the wait.

I understand this may be quite disappointing for many of you (especially those that told me it was going to be released on your birthday). I promise this is the final delay. I will press the launch button on September 24th; no exceptions.

And if you decided to read the Bad News first, I hope the Good News gets you excited again!
